Output 8c59b5d699fa573f7be54d6c3b4629e2cc454726baf28da9d9ca3091d0e78741:1

value
27087594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de8b86e5a5e9c936239ad089a89c2b05c35c4243 OP_EQUALVERIFY OP_CHECKSIG
address
1MHiA67kqatbp1tbVTPzvDDTLpX22mdXQ5
transaction
8c59b5d699fa573f7be54d6c3b4629e2cc454726baf28da9d9ca3091d0e78741
spent
true